The Organising Committee SERCON 23 is very happy to welcome you to the SER 10th annual conference which will be held in NIMHANS, Bangalore between 14th & 15th October, 2023. The meeting is being organized in collaboration with the Department of “Neuroimaging and Interventional Radiology, NIMHANS, Bangalore”. We welcome all experts, academicians, delegates and students to the SER 10th annual conference. We invite you all to the 2-day educational program covering various aspects of Emergency Radiology. The scientific program of the conference includes multiple scientific sessions, discussions, oral presentations, poster presentations and quizzes. The academic extravaganza features a gamut of distinguished national and international speakers slated to enlighten the assembly on diverse topics in emergency radiology. About the Venue

The National Institute of Mental Health and Neuro-Sciences (NIMHANS) is the apex centre for mental health and neuroscience education in the country. It is an Institute of National Importance operates autonomously under the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are. The history of the institute dates back to 1847 and was the first institute in India for postgraduate training in psychiatry.

The National Institute of Mental Health and Neurosciences (NIMHANS) was the result of the amalgamation of the erstwhile State Mental Hospital and the All India Institute of Mental Health (AIIMH) established by the Government of India in 1954. The institute was inaugurated on 27 December 1974, establishing it as an autonomous body and lead in the area of medical service and research in the country.

On 14 November 1994, NIMHANS was conferred a deemed university status by the University Grants Commission with academic autonomy. The institute has been declared as an Institute of National Importance by an act of parliament in 2012.
